Block

#21,984,741
Block Number
21,984,741 @ 06/19/2025, 23:45:00
Status
Finalized
ID
0x014f75e5c9e0694a1013bdaad5a131a8ea6c5b2d5c6984c2372fc29882caf1de
Transactions
Gas Used
6360505/40000000 (15.90% Used)
Total Score
2,147,154,340 (+98)
Rewards
26.38 VTHO